Veteran Journalist Srimal Abeyewardene passes away

Date:

Colombo (LNW): Veteran journalist Srimal Abeyewardene passed away aged 79.

Abeyewardene is the founder of The Sri Lanka Reporter, an award-winning English newspaper that catered to the Sri Lankans living in Canada.

He leaves behind a legacy that spans five decades in the media industry and has significantly impacted the Sri Lankan community living in Canada.

He was living in Toronto, Canada at the time of his demise.

Throughout his career, Abeyewardene worked in a number of media agencies, including Ceylon Daily News, Sun-Davasa Group, Times of Ceylon, and Daily News.

Following his migration to Canada in 1988, Abeyewardene was recognised as the largest English Sri Lankan newspaper in North America.
